Kate’s on the cover of in the April issue of Glamour, out March 10.

Katie Holmes wants to address the hottest subject of tabloid speculation about her.
“Well, I’m not pregnant right now,” she says in the April issue of Glamour, out March 10.

In the interview, which was done in early February, she also talks about husband Tom Cruise’s concern over how gossip might be affecting her: “We were changing diapers. He said, ‘I don’t want you to get upset.’ And I said, ‘Well, I am upset.’ So we approached it together. But I definitely felt like — as a woman, as the mother of Suri — I want to handle this.”

The couple will celebrate their third wedding anniversary this year. And Holmes, 30, says she would like to celebrate in Rome, “one of the first places we went together” and where they wed.

Globe-trotting is a regular feature of her life. After her Broadway turn in Arthur Miller’s All My Sons with John Lithgow, Dianne Wiest and Patrick Wilson ended in January, she made headlines with her trips to Brazil and Disney World with her husband, 46, and their daughter, who turns 3 in April.

When they’re not traveling, life is routine. “We like to be together,” she says. They “play Yahtzee, board games, Scrabble. We grill, have pool parties. We play The Three Little Pigs, and Suri is the Big Bad Wolf.”

Cruise “reads storybooks to Suri, and we all laugh. When a good song comes on, he’ll break into dance. We’ll watch movies in bed — recently Madagascar and Cinderella, for Suri.”

But Holmes does say there’s one area in which she needs improvement. “I don’t really cook that much — eventually, I will. I do make cupcakes. And (Cruise) makes his pasta carbonara for me. He knows exactly how to do it: a pinch of this, a pinch of that. He has a recipe, but he also kind of (improvises).”

The actress, who is back in New York on the set of the comedy The Extra Man, might have to put cooking lessons on the back burner. Despite her busy schedule, she is working on a little-girls’ clothing line.

“My friend Jeanne Yang and I have been working together,” Holmes tells Glamour. “She’s got twin girls about 6 years old, and we both grew up with mothers who sewed. We started about a year ago, sketching different things, trying to find comfortable clothing for our daughters that is also pretty and cute. We just started, and we’ve played around with doing things for women as well.”

She also joked that she was destined to wed Tom, 46, after watching his blockbuster “Top Gun” as a giggly, little schoolgirl in 1986:

“When ‘Top Gun’ came out, my sisters were like, ‘Oh, my God, ‘Top Gun’! Tom Cruise!’ And I very confidently said, ‘I’m going to marry him one day,’ It wasn’t like, ‘How do I get to Tom Cruise?’ It was just, ‘I think I’m going to marry him. Why not? He’ll like me. I’m fun.’ ” said Holmes, who poses in costumes inspired by Broadway legend Bob Fosse.

Becoming a mother has allowed Katie Holmes to flex muscles she wasn’t even aware she possessed.

Motherhood, the parent of 2-year-old Suri Cruise tells Glamour magazine for April’s special 70th anniversary issue (on sale March 10), “has been the most amazing experience – in an instant you become strong. You have to be a little bit wiser; it’s the most important job in the world.”

Not that having a child wasn’t a formidable experience for Holmes, 30, and husband Tom Cruise, 46. “During the first couple of days [with Suri], we would just sleep right next to her to make sure she was breathing. And I was constantly learning on the job, but Tom was very helpful and supportive.”

Addressing Rumors
Asked about the rumors that were once swirling around the Cruise marriage – including one story that Suri didn’t exist at all – Holmes responds, “Some of the stuff [people said] was such absolutely horrible things to say about a child. It was so uncalled for and so disgusting. Enough is enough.”

In such instances, she says, Cruise, who was more accustomed to press coverage, was extremely helpful, says his wife.

“We were changing diapers. He said, ‘I don’t want you to get upset.’ And I said, ‘Well, I am upset.’ So we approached it together.” To those who write or report such things, Holmes says she’d like to tell them, “Why don’t you come over and have dinner? See what there is to see.”

Through such adversity Holmes also says she has developed a sense of self-reliance. “I definitely felt like – as a woman, as the mother of Suri – I want to handle this! My mom is very strong, and if anyone ever said anything about any of us, she would be, ‘Excuse’ me? That’s my family!”

Speaking of which, the Cruises are not about to add to theirs – at least for the moment. Asked about a current rumor, Holmes answers, “I’m not pregnant right now.”
